Pool Leak Water Removal Cost in Poquoson, VA
The cost of Pool Leak Water Removal in Poquoson, VA can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ate for your service, and we’ll work with you to create a customized plan to fit your needs and bud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Pool Leak Detection |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the leak. |
| Pool Leak Repair | $500 – $2,500 | The type of materials needed to repair the leak and the labor required to complete the job. |
| Water Damage Cleanup |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the extent of the water damage. |
| Pool Equipment Repair | $500 – $2,000 | The type of equipment needed to repair and the labor required to complete the job. |
| Moisture Removal |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the moisture removal process.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$200 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the extent of the cleanup required. |

What causes pool leaks?
Pool le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including worn-out equipment, cracks in the pool shell, and poor maintenance.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and provide a solution to fix it.
